Hobson Road apartment fire causes heavy damage
Fort Wayne Fire Department units were dispatched for a reported apartment building fire in the area of Lake Avenue and Hobson Road at approximately 7 p.m. on Sept. 15.
First crews arrived on the scene finding a two-story apartment building with heavy fire engulfing two separate apartments on the first and second floors and extending to the neighboring apartments.
The fire was upgraded to a 705 alarm, bringing in an extra fire engine, along with six other apparatus responding. Crews pulled multiple hose lines and made entry into both apartments, fighting the fire from the interior and exterior.
Other crews made entry inside neighboring apartments, stopping any extending fire from spreading to the rest of the building. All occupants either escaped or were not home at the time of the fire.
A total of 17 occupants were displaced due to the damage. No injuries were reported. Investigators are still working the scene, attempting to figure out the cause.
AEP, NIPSCO, FWPD, TRAA, Neighborhood Code Enforcement and the Allen County Building Department all assisted on the scene.
